site

The landing page for the wdl-dev repositories, served as a single WDL Worker — and it's live at wdl.dev.

This is a standard WDL Worker project — scaffolded with wdl init and deployed through the wdl CLI (npm run deploywdl deploy .), the same path any tenant uses. src/index.js renders the page HTML; the CSS, logo, and favicon are served from the ASSETS store and resolved at request time with env.ASSETS.url(). There is no local fallback — develop by deploying and testing on the platform.

Layout

src/index.js             worker entry — renders the page and the repo list
public/                  ASSETS: styles.css, favicon.svg
brand/WDL-black.svg      brand source the favicon is generated from
scripts/build-logo.mjs   regenerates public/favicon.svg from brand/WDL-black.svg
wrangler.jsonc           worker config (assets.directory = ./public, route wdl.dev/*)
AGENTS.md / CLAUDE.md    pointers to the per-feature docs shipped with @wdl-dev/cli

The repositories shown on the page are defined in the REPOS array at the top of src/index.js. The page styling lives in public/styles.css.

Brand assets

public/favicon.svg is generated from brand/WDL-black.svg. After changing the brand files, regenerate it:

npm run build:logo

Deploy

Releases go through the wdl CLI — not wrangler deploy (which targets Cloudflare). The wdl.dev route is operator-declared; this repo claims it via routes in wrangler.jsonc.

npm install
npm run dry-run    # wrangler bundle check, nothing uploaded
npm run deploy     # wdl deploy . --ns site — bundles, uploads assets, promotes
